Life's a beach means something positive. Almost like "Life is good". Who doesn't like a beach? The beach makes you relaxed, feel warm, have fun in the water, enjoy life. "Life's a Beach" denotes that life is good or great. The phrase was invented to counteract the negative phrase of "Life's a bitch".